Some questions (just started BMXing)

I'm just a beginner and bought my first BMX, it's K2 Reaper (pic and info) . I'm planning to ride mostly on street. Did I choose a good bike? It seems that the body is pretty thick and heavy compared to many other BMX's, not sure though... Actually I didn't have much choice here in Finland, not many shops selling BMX's.

Also, any tips learning the basic tricks are certainly welcome. I can't do even the bunny hop well yet. Should manual be hard to learn?

its weird to tell someone how to bunnyhop and maunal cuz every one does it different. just try different ways and they work off of that in to your own way. i do mine really weird cuz i used to race so i tuck my bike up when i get max height which means its harder for me to do tricks. but i have learned better like going from manual to bunny hop to manual. just work at your own pace. your bike will be decent for now. i mean u'll want better as u move on but a heavy bike makes big muscles so later a light bike will be easy to move around you. thats what its like for me atleast. once again people have there own styles nad thats mine.
